Mark 16:11
Comments
Mary’s report is met with unbelief. Mark picks out just that thread: the unbelief of the disciples. That is what he is inspired to report; that is the concern of his record: that they did not believe Christ’s previous words, nor Mary’s report, nor the report of the other women (Luke 24:11). But notice it is plural: ‘And they, when they had heard that he was alive, and had been seen of her, believed not.’ This becomes important to understand what follows. Christ consistently uses the plural – ‘they’, ‘them’ – to refer to the disciples. We should note this as we go on through the verses.
